    M424G Features

    • NMEA 0183 connectivity
    • AIS target all when hooked up with an MA-500TR kit
    • AquaQuake™ draining function
    • Weather channels with alert function
    • Dual/tri-watch function
    • Priority and normal scan
    • Class D DSC. Learn how to register your DSC radio – Watch video  |  Download DSC Quick Guide

    M504 Features

    • Dual/tri-watch function for monitoring Ch.16 and/or call channel
    • Instant access to Ch. 16 and call channel
    • 7 levels adjustable backlit display and keypad
    • Convenient “TAG” scanning function with simple add/delete
    • Optional Voice Scrambler, UT-112 for private communication
    • Weather channels with weather alert function
    • Black or gray color versions

    IC-M59 – VHF Mounted Marine Transceiver

    Quick Specs:
    VHF mounted marine transceiver
    RX/TX: all USA, Canadian and international marine channels
    RX only: 10 weather channels
    Output power: 25 W
    Modes: FM
    Receiver sensitivity: 0.22 µV (FM, 12 dB SINAD)
    DSC capable (optional)
    Detailed Specifications

    GENERAL

    • Frequency Coverage: Transmit: 156.025 -157.425 MHz; Receive: 156.025 – 163.275 MHz
    • Usable channels: All U.S.A., International and Canadian channels; plus 10 weather channels
    • Mode: FM (16K0G3E); DSC (16K0G2B; with optional UX-120)
    • Power Supply Requirement: 13.8 V DC +/-15% (negative ground)
    • Current Drain (at 13.8 V DC):
      • Transmit: 6.0 (high); 1.5 A (low)
      • Receive: 1.2 A (max. audio); 350 mA (standby)
    • Usable Temperature Range: -20°C~ to +60°C (-4°F to +140°F)
    • Antenna connector: 50 ohms (SO-239)
    • Dimensions: 166(W) x 70(H) x 175(D) mm; 6.52(W) x 2.75(H) x 6.84(D) in (projections not included)
    • Weight: 1.0 kg; 2.2 lb

    TRANSMITTER

    • Output Power (at 13.8 V): 25 W (high); 1 W (low)
    • Modulation System: Variable reactance phase modulation
    • Spurious Emissions: Less than -70 dB
    • Noise and hum: 40 dB
    • Microphone Impedance: 600 ohms

    RECEIVER

    • Receiver System: Double-conversion superheterodyne
    • Intermediate Frequencies: 1st: 21.8 MHz; 2nd: 455 kHz
    • Sensitivity: 0.22µV for 12 dB SINAD (typical)
    • Squelch sensitivity (at threshold): 0.18 µV
    • Adjacent channel selectivity: 70 dB
    • Spurious Response Rejection Ratio: 70 dB
    • Intermodulation rejection ratio: 70 dB
    • Audio Output Power: More than 3.5 W with a 4 ohms load
    • Audio Output Impedance: 4 ohms

    IC-M59 Options

    Some versions cannot use all the options listed here since type approval for the IC-M59 varies between countries. Ask your dealer which options are available.

    • SP-5 EXTERNAL SPEAKER: A large, external speaker for superior audio output.
    • SP-10 EXTERNAL SPEAKER: A compact, external speaker. Features easy installation.
    • MB-28 FLUSH MOUNT: For mounting the IC-M59 to a panel. Available in white or black.
    • PS-66 DC-DC CONVERTER: Enables use of a 24 V boat battery. Input voltage: 19 to 32 V DC; Output voltage: 13.6 V DC
    • UT-79 VOICE SCRAMBLER UNIT: Provides 128 analog voice scramble codes for private communications.
    • UX-120 DSC UNIT: Provides the IC-M59 with DSC capabilities which comply with U.S. Coast Guard proposal SC-101 for marine digital communications.
    • OPC-457 NMEA CABLE: For connecting a GPS receiver to send positioning data with DSC calls via the UX-120.

    M605 Features

    • Active noise cancelling
    • Last call voice recording saves the last two minutes of the last incoming call or start recording manually
    • Integrated GNSS receiver
    • Class D DSC
    • Weather & alert channels
    • AquaQuake® draining function
    • Instant access to channel 16 and channel 09 call channel

    M700PRO Features

    • Automatic antenna tuner, the AT-140, is available to match the transceiver to your antenna
    • Numerous operating modes* available: USB, AM, CW, FSK and AFSK
      *Ask your dealer for details.
    • Wide band, general coverage receive — 0.5 to 29.9999 MHz
    • Channel/frequency knob allows the user to tune specific frequencies around the memory channel
    • NMEA plus 2 DIN connectors are available for external equipment connection, such as a linear amplifier, FSK terminal, E-mail modem, etc.
    • Optional 2-tone alarm function (UT-95 2-TONE ALARM UNIT required) provides simple transmission of emergency signals
    • NMEA0813 interface included

    M710 Features

    • Covers all allowed bands between 1.6 and 27.5 MHz
    • General coverage receiver
    • Modes: SSB, RTTY, CW and AM
    • 2182 kHz alarm built-in (optional for General versions)
    • RF gain control
    • Audio activated squelch
    • Terminals for frequency/mode control via NMEA interfacing
    • Direct keypad channel selection entry
    • Large, front-mounted speaker
    • Direct keypad channel selection entry
    • Weather fax ready
    • Backlight control
    • CW full break-in and semi break-in
